package internal import ( "testing" "time" ) func TestConfig_Validate(t *testing.T) { type fields struct { DnsRecordsToCheck []string PublicIpResolverTag string ApiToken string CloudflareZone string OnChangeComment string CheckInterval time.Duration } tests := []struct { name string fields fields wantErr bool }{ { name: "all ok", fields: fields{ DnsRecordsToCheck: []string{"domain1", "domain2"}, ApiToken: "some_api_key", CloudflareZone: "some_zone", }, wantErr: false, }, { name: "empty api token", fields: fields{ DnsRecordsToCheck: []string{"domain1", "domain2"}, ApiToken: "", CloudflareZone: "some_zone", }, wantErr: true, }, { name: "empty check dns record", fields: fields{ DnsRecordsToCheck: []string{}, ApiToken: "", CloudflareZone: "some_zone", }, wantErr: true, }, { name: "empty zone", fields: fields{ DnsRecordsToCheck: []string{"domain1", "domain2"}, ApiToken: "some_api_key", CloudflareZone: "", }, wantErr: true, }, } for _, tt := range tests { t.Run(tt.name, func(t *testing.T) { c := Config{ DnsRecordsToCheck: tt.fields.DnsRecordsToCheck, PublicIpResolverTag: tt.fields.PublicIpResolverTag, ApiToken: tt.fields.ApiToken, CloudflareZone: tt.fields.CloudflareZone, OnChangeComment: tt.fields.OnChangeComment, CheckInterval: tt.fields.CheckInterval, } if err := c.Validate(); (err != nil) != tt.wantErr { t.Errorf("Validate() error = %v, wantErr %v", err, tt.wantErr) } }) } }
